Citadel Explosion

So, we grab the Gravity Gun, replenish our health, and go down after Brin.

The plan is as follows: climb up and destroy the portal. We'll ascend, going counterclockwise around Brin (he's in the shiny ball in the center). The passage on the right won't open right away—we'll wait. Then we'll pass three generators, first knocking out the energy balls. Next, we'll climb higher on the moving platform and continue on.

We'll approach the center and climb higher, then higher again, and finally, the final platform, where we'll reach the very spot from which we can destroy the portal. Naturally, the portal can only be destroyed with energy balls. However, the portal is covered by a protective frame from the front, so we'll retreat to the far left or right.

Two stormtroopers will complicate the destruction of the portal, but shooting them down is both difficult and completely unnecessary. We'll fire the balls at the rotating parts of the portal. We need to destroy the portal as quickly as possible, otherwise Brin will escape, and we'll lose.

After the portal is destroyed, Alix comes running and says that we need to get out of here, otherwise...
